Exam Dates 2021: Check All The Dates For JEE, NEET, CBSE Exams Here

The Education Minister has provided clarity on the dates of some of the upcoming exams this year. Here a look at the dates for JEE, NEET, and CBSE Board exams.

New Delhi: The coronavirus pandemic had created a lot of problems for students and uncertainty over exams last year. While there were speculations that exams will be cancelled due to the pandemic, competitive exams such as JEE and NEET following strict Covid-19 protocols. Last month the Education Minister Ramesh Pokhriyal Nishank gave more clarity about the exams in 2021. Here's a look at the dates for the upcoming exams. This year the JEE Main exams will be held in multiple shifts— February, March, April, and May. Candidates will be allowed to attempt all four times if they wish, with the best score being used. Pokhriyal said that pattern of the exam has also been changed to accommodate COVID-19-driven changes to the syllabus. According to the official notification dating 16 December 2020, the exams will be held on the following dates. First session: 23,24,25 & 26 February 2021 Second session: 15,16,17,& 18 March 2021 Third session: 27,28,29 & 30 April 2021 Fourth Session: 24,25,26 27 & 28 May 2021 For BE/ B.Tech (Paper 1) and B. Arch (Paper 2 A)the exams will be held in two shifts- 9 AM to 12 PM and 3 PM to 6 PM. While B. Planning (Paper 2 B) will be held from 3 PM to 6 PM. CBSE Boards: The Union Minister for Education Ramesh Pokhriyal Nishank has announced the date of commencement for Class 10 and Class 12 CBSE board exams 2021he Class 10 and 12 exams will begin from May 4, 2021 and they are scheduled to be concluded by June 10, 2021. Schools have been allowed to conduct practicals for both classes from March 1, 2021, till the last date for conducting theory exams. The results are tentatively planned to be announced by July 15, 2021. National Eligibility cum Entrance Test (NEET):  The dates for the NEET exams are yet to be out. During a webinar, Pokhriyal has said that there are no plans to cancel NEET. He also said that NEET will be held offline due to the requirement of the exams. The information will be updated on NTA NEET website - ntaneet.nic.in . The NTA usually conducts the examination on the first Sunday of May. But so far there is no clarity on the dates by the testing agency.
